Sinkhole filling services involve the process of repairing and stabilizing ground areas that have developed cavities or collapses beneath the surface. When a sinkhole forms, it can cause the ground to suddenly give way, leading to damage to driveways, lawns, or even the foundation of a property. Professional contractors typically assess the size and severity of the sinkhole, then use specialized materials and techniques to fill the void, restore the ground’s stability, and prevent further collapse. This work is essential for maintaining the safety and integrity of a property affected by ground subsidence.

These services help address a variety of problems caused by sinkholes, including uneven ground surfaces, cracked pavement, and compromised foundations. Sinkholes can develop gradually or suddenly, often resulting from underground erosion or the collapse of subterranean cavities. If left untreated, they can worsen over time, creating hazards for residents and leading to costly structural repairs. Filling a sinkhole promptly can help prevent further ground movement, protect property value, and ensure the safety of those living or working nearby.

Properties that most often require sinkhole filling services include residential homes, commercial buildings, and land parcels situated in areas prone to ground instability. Homes with cracked walls, uneven floors, or foundation shifts may be experiencing underlying ground issues that need professional attention. Commercial properties, especially those with underground utilities or parking lots, can also be vulnerable to sinkholes. Landowners planning development or landscaping projects might seek these services to stabilize the soil before construction begins. In general, any property showing signs of ground subsidence or damage should be evaluated by experienced service providers.

The overview below groups typical Sinkhole Filling proj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Cincinnati, OH.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or sinkhole filling projects in Cincinnati range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, covering shallow or localized fill work. Larger or more complex repairs tend to cost more, but most projects stay within this band.

Medium-Sized Projects - for more extensive sinkhole filling, costs generally range from $600-$2,000. These projects often involve deeper fills or moderate excavation, with many local contractors providing services within this price bracket. Fewer projects reach into the higher end of this range.

Large or Complex Fillings - extensive repairs involving significant excavation or stabilization can cost from $2,000-$5,000. Such projects are less common and typically involve more detailed work to ensure long-term stability, with prices varying based on site conditions.

Full Replacement or Stabilization - complete sinkhole replacement or foundational stabilization may exceed $5,000, depending on size and complexity. These larger projects are less frequent and can involve substantial excavation, materials, and labor costs, which local service providers can estimate based on specific site needs.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es a sinkhole to form? Sinkholes can develop due to natural underground erosion, soil instability, or excess water runoff weakening the ground surface.

How can I tell if I have a sinkhole on my property? Signs include sudden ground depression, cracked walls or pavement, and doors or windows that no longer close properly.

What are the benefits of filling a sinkhole? Filling a sinkhole can help stabilize the ground, prevent further damage, and restore the safety of the affected area.

What methods do local contractors use to fill sinkholes? Contractors may use techniques such as soil stabilization, grouting, or backfilling with suitable materials to address sinkholes.
